Olivier Rœllinger's words
Pompona vanilla beans from Peru has surprisingly intense flavor notes with hints of caramel and Tonka bean. They also have a powdery, floral scent reminiscent of almond milk.
Story
Pompona vanilla beans (Vanilla Pompona Grandiflora) are a rare vanilla variety grown at 800 meters above sea level in northern Peru. It is among the twenty or so woodland vanilla varieties have been identified in Peru and is native to the Peruvian forest. The beans are cultivated using permaculture techniques on small coffee and cocoa farms and have been traditionally used to make skin creams for local women. Pompona vanilla beans are a rare type of vanilla that truly comes into its own when infused in liquids .
